Tourist tax & Guest Card
The tourist tax of the Bergerlebnis Berchtesgaden AssociationThe current tourist tax charged by the Bergerlebnis Berchtesgaden Association is per person and per night:
3.10 Euro for adults
1.55 Euro for children and teenagers
(as of March 2023)
The tourist tax is paid directly to your host.

The Bergerlebnis Berchtesgaden Guest Card
You’ll receive your Guest Card directly from your host. You can access your digital Guest Card before arrival via MAXL, your digital travel companion.
Easy, low-impact travel during your stay—free with your Berchtesgaden Guest Card
With your Guest Card, you travel free across the entire RVO bus network and by train throughout the region. Getting to Bad Reichenhall, Salzburg, the Rupertiwinkel, or even Lake Chiemsee is simple and stress-free—no traffic, no searching for parking.
A few services are excluded: the Kehlstein line, the ALMErlebnisBUS, routes to Salzburg, and the bus on the Rossfeld Panoramic Road. For these, you’ll need a separate ticket or pay a surcharge.
Important: Upon request, you must present a valid photo ID together with your Guest Card.
Berchtesgaden’s attractions—better value with your Guest Card
With your Guest Card, you’ll enjoy reduced admission at many of Berchtesgaden’s top attractions and sights—and even at select locations in the surrounding area. Simply show your (digital) Guest Card at the ticket desk and take advantage of the savings.
